Frequently asked questions

How often do Russia and Slovenia vote together at the UN?

Russia and Slovenia voted the same way in 62.7% of 2,425 shared UN General Assembly votes since 1946.

Do Russia and Slovenia agree on human rights votes?

On human rights resolutions, Russia and Slovenia are split: they voted the same way in 49.5% of 566 shared human-rights votes at the UN General Assembly.
